50-Hour Maintenance

Every 50 hours of operation
(more frequently in dusty or dirty
conditions):
Lubricate the gearcase. To
perform this operation, first remove
the gearcase (A) from the outer
tube (B).

Cutter Blade Adjustment

WARNING!
The cutter blades are very sharp!
Always wear gloves when working
around the cutter assembly.
CAUTION!
Operating the trimmer with worn
or improperly adjusted cutters will
reduce cutter performance and may
also damage your machine.
Cutter performance of your machine
depends in great measure on the
cutter blade clearance. Properly ad-
justed blades will oscillate freely yet
help prevent binding of cut material
between blades. Adjust the blades
as follows:

1. Loosen all the blade locknuts (A) at
least one full turn.
2. Tighten each blade shoulder bolt (B)
firmly, and then loosen the shoulder
bolts 1/4 to 1/2 turn.
3. Working from the gearcase end, lock
each bolt in place by firmly tighten-
ing its locknut while preventing the
shoulder bolt from turning.
When shoulder bolt adjustment is cor-
rect, there should be a gap of 0.25–0.50
mm between the cutter blades and the
flat washers (C) beneath each bolt head
should turn freely.
